Description of the product and settings
The EE880 motion detector is sensitive to infrared
radiation emitted as heat from a moving body. The
detector switches on the load connected to it when a
heat-emitting body moves within in its detection area.
The load remains lit for the period of time to which the
detector has been set and until it no longer detects
movement in its surveillance area. This detector has
been specially designed to meet the needs of corridors.

Installation advice
For installation in damp locations, a drain hole 8
needs to be drilled in the protective cover.
There is a cable feedthrough that can be broken open
if necessary 9 on the protective cover.
Surface mounting of the EE880
1. Loosen the screws 4 retaining the lid 5.
2. Remove the lid 5.
3. Use 2 screws to fix the box 6 to the ceiling or wall
(diameter 4.5 mm and length 50 mm).
4. Wire the detector in accordance with the connection
diagrams (see "Connections").
5. Refit the lid 5.
6. Correctly tighten the two screws 4 retaining the lid
5 in order to ensure a good seal.
7. Adjust the potentiometers (see "potentiometer
settings").
8. Fit the protective cover 7. Be sure to press on the
cover to ensure that it clips in place correctly
Important
The detector requires 10 seconds to initialize after
the power is switched on.

Functions
V pulse function
On potentiometer 2, the pulse function applies a
voltage to the output for 2 seconds. This function is
not used to directly control the loads, but to control a
stairwell timer, for example.

Use/maintenance
The detector is designed for automatic switching
of lighting. However, it is not intended for use with
antiintrusion alarms, because it is not protected
against vandalism.
If the surface gets dirty, clean it with a damp cloth (do
not use detergent).
Connection in parallel
Parallel implementation is possible, but care must be
taken not to exceed the maximum power that can be
connected to a detector. Moreover, all the devices
must be connected to the same phase.

What to do if ... ?
After a power cut
• The detector continues to operate with the luminosity
threshold indicated by potentiometer 1.
• When potentiometer 1 is in learning mode the
luminosity level set before the power cut is still in
memory, the detector does not resume learning mode.
• If it was in constant lighting mode, then the detector
returns to detection mode.
